About Spire Bristol Hospital
Spire Bristol Hospital, in the Redland area of the city, is one of the South West's principal private hospitals. Part of Spire Healthcare, it provides planned treatment across specialties including orthopaedics, general surgery, gynaecology, urology, cardiology, ENT and ophthalmology, with extensive outpatient clinics and on-site imaging supporting rapid diagnosis and treatment planning.
Patients are treated by consultants of their choice and stay in private en-suite rooms with dedicated nursing support, while on-site physiotherapy aids rehabilitation. The hospital carries out day-case and inpatient surgery and treats patients using private medical insurance as well as self-funding patients, with fixed prices for many procedures.

How to access Spire Bristol Hospital
With health insurance
Check the hospital is on your insurer's list (most major insurers include Spire Healthcare facilities), get a GP or direct-access referral, then pre-authorise the treatment with your insurer.
Self-pay
Ask the hospital for a fixed-price package quote — most offer them for common procedures, with payment plans often available.
NHS-funded
Some private hospitals treat NHS patients for certain procedures. Ask your GP whether choosing this hospital through the NHS e-Referral system is possible for your treatment.

Frequently asked questions
Is Spire Bristol Hospital NHS or private?
Spire Bristol Hospital is a private hospital, part of Spire Healthcare. Some private hospitals also treat NHS-funded patients for certain procedures under the NHS e-Referral system — ask your GP whether that's an option for your treatment.
Can I be treated at Spire Bristol Hospital with health insurance?
Most major UK health insurers include Spire Healthcare facilities on their network, but always check your specific policy first. Spire Bristol works with all major UK health insurers including Bupa, AXA Health, Aviva and Vitality, and typically offers fixed-price self-pay packages.
Can I self-pay at Spire Bristol Hospital without insurance?
Yes — most private hospitals, including this one, offer fixed-price self-pay packages for common procedures, often with payment plans available. Ask the hospital directly for a quote.
What is Spire Bristol Hospital's CQC rating?
Spire Bristol Hospital is rated "Good" by the Care Quality Commission (CQC), England's independent regulator for health and social care providers. Ratings can change after inspections — see the reviews section on this page for the current figure and source.
